Congressman Conaway says further steps needed after second Bannon interview

Texas Congressman Mike Conaway leaves an interview by the House Intelligence Committee with former Trump campaign and administration official Steve Bannon that the Committee was moving to the next steps of the investigation and he did not answer all the questions they would like to have answered, so there was frustration. Conaway says he answered each of the 25 questions authorized by the White House, so there are further steps to take and they would be taken. Conaway says contempt is a big deal and he does not have unilateral control of that conversation, but the importance of House equities and subpoenas would be discussed.
